A central air conditioning conditioner cools air in one spot prior to dispersing it throughout the home utilizing the heating system’s air handling abilities. This sets it apart from window or wall air conditioning unit or mini-split systems, which all chill relatively small locations and need numerous systems to cool the whole home.
Most single-family houses in the United States with central air conditioning utilize a split system. This suggests that the gadget is divided into 2 parts: an evaporator coil within your house and a compressor exterior.

Your contractor will help you in determining the appropriate size central air conditioning conditioner for your home. A unit that is too little will run almost constantly, whereas a system that is too big will chill the house too quickly and turn off before completing a full cycle.
The quick on/off in the latter situation is taxing on the system. It can cause the evaporator coil to freeze, and a frozen coil prevents air from flowing. As a result, a huge air conditioner may be less reliable at cooling than a smaller system.
Your Air Conditioner installation will do a computation called a “Manual-J” to determine the very best unit for your home. This will take into account all of the criteria we’ve discussed and more, resulting in the most exact size possible.
However, we comprehend that many homeowners like to have a general notion of what size they need ahead of time. central air conditioner size: To get the Btu needed, increase the square footage of your house’s conditioned location by 25, then divide by 12,000 to acquire the tonnage.
Keep in mind that this is merely a fundamental price quote, and there are numerous factors. If your house’s first flooring has 12-foot ceilings, the air conditioner will have more air to chill.

Rates vary based on the regional market and the job details, just like any considerable task. For labor and supplies, a normal split system central air conditioning installation utilizing an existing furnace could cost in between $3,000 and $7,000 or more. Usually, that cost will be split around 60/40, with labor accounting for bulk of it.
